GitHub is a public platform. Anyone can create a repository and upload any file—including text files containing WiFi passwords. However, these are rarely “master keys” to the internet. Instead, they fall into several categories:

Power users sync their Linux dotfiles ( .bashrc , .config ) to GitHub for backup. If they hardcoded a WiFi password into a setup script or stored a wpa_supplicant.conf in their home directory, that file goes public.
